Everybody will tell you the best bang for your buck is the plenum spacer for our cars which is completely true. It helps air flow into the engine better than the stock hands down. Very simple to do probly 20-30 mins for first timers. I can't say that it gave huge gains..haven't dyno'd my car (yet). But it honestly felt a lil faster and the throttle was more responsive. If your going for more power in your car it's a mod that is cheap (compared to other mods) and it does indeed help the car out
